Is Kahului cheaper than Honolulu?
Kahului is cheaper than Honolulu in the current Hawaii dataset because Kahului median home price is $900,000 while Honolulu median home price is $1,000,000.
Kahului is a strong relocation city for movers who want practical Maui access, airport and service convenience, and a more functional day-to-day setup than resort-heavy parts of the island provide. Kahului is not a frictionless move because Kahului also combines expensive housing, island logistics, and a city identity built more around practicality than around postcard-style beach living.
Kahului sits below Honolulu and above Hilo in the current dataset while staying above the statewide Hawaii housing baseline. Kahului should be judged as Hawaii's practical Maui option rather than as the state's cheapest city or its most urban city.

Kahului neighborhood selection matters because Central Kahului, Maui Lani, and The Parkways solve different daily-life problems. Central Kahului fits movers who want the most practical service access, Maui Lani fits movers who want a more polished planned residential setting, and The Parkways fits movers who want a more organized suburban routine.
Kahului is most attractive to movers who want Maui living without centering the move on a resort-market fantasy. Kahului often works well for healthcare workers, logistics households, service-sector professionals, and families that care more about practical island access than about nightlife or a highly urban daily pattern.
Kahului deserves more caution from movers who want Hawaii's broadest job base, the lowest-cost island housing path, or a lifestyle centered on walkable urban energy. Kahului also deserves caution from households that underestimate wildfire awareness and Maui housing pressure.
